What is this device?

This is the USB identifier for a PortStation SCSI Module manufactured by Xircom. The vendor ID 085a is registered to Xircom with the USB Implementers Forum, and 0032 is the product ID that Xircom assigned to this particular model. When you run lsusb on Linux, this device appears as 085a:0032 Xircom PortStation SCSI Module.

How to identify it on your system

Linux

$ lsusb
Bus 001 Device 004: ID 085a:0032 Xircom PortStation SCSI Module

You can filter directly with lsusb -d 085a:0032, or get the full descriptor dump with lsusb -v -d 085a:0032. Kernel messages from dmesg show the same pair as idVendor=085a, idProduct=0032.

Windows

In Device Manager, open the device, go to Details → Hardware Ids. This device reports:

USB\VID_085A&PID_0032
USB\VID_085A&PID_0032&REV_0100

From PowerShell: Get-PnpDevice | Where-Object InstanceId -match "VID_085A&PID_0032"

macOS

$ system_profiler SPUSBDataType
    PortStation SCSI Module:
      Product ID: 0x0032
      Vendor ID: 0x085a  (Xircom)
